James H. Boykin is a Partner in the Washington, DC, office of Hexagon and Co-Chair of the firm’s international commercial arbitration and investor-state arbitration practice groups. 

James’ practice focuses on international arbitration and international litigation. Over the past two decades, James has successfully represented numerous investors in investment treaty arbitrations in proceedings conducted under the ICSID, UNCITRAL, and SCC Rules. He also frequently represents clients in international and domestic commercial arbitrations under all major rule-sets (e.g., ICDR, ICC, LCIA).  

James has developed deep expertise with the enforcement of arbitral awards in the United States. He is regularly retained to coordinate global enforcement efforts on behalf of award creditors.     

A leader in is field, James has been recognized by all leading legal directories, including Chambers & Partners, Legal 500, Best Lawyers, and Lexology. In 2026, Lexology named him a “Thought Leader” (Lexology Arbitration 2026).

Prior to founding Hexagon Advocates, James practiced at leading international law firm Hughes Hubbard & Reed LLP, where he was an equity partner and Global Co-Head of International Arbitration.  

He is a member of the Expedited Commercial Panel of the American Arbitration Association and serves on the Arbitration Council of the German Arbitration Institute (DIS).
